    Default Stepped stair landing

    I have an "L" shaped stair that due to space restrictions I need to add a step at a 45 degree angle across the landing, (this one step would kinda simulate a spiral staircase).

    It seems using boundaries should work here but I'm not having much luck.

    Any ideas on how to accomplish this?

    Just create a normal run L shaped stairs then click riser button and draw the 45 degrees line but since you are adding one new riser you need to delete one riser say the top most riser line then trim your boundary at the top as mentioned by beegee....
